The Rise of Smart Apparel and Gadgets for Kids

Smart clothing is a growing trend in kids' fashion. These items combine technology with everyday wear. Some clothes have GPS trackers for safety. Others monitor health data like heart rate or body temperature. Smart fabrics can change color or pattern with app controls. This adds a fun, interactive element to kids' wardrobes. Wearable devices like smartwatches are popular with older kids. They offer features like step counting and communication. Some smart clothes are designed to help with posture or sleep. This trend shows how fashion and technology are merging for kids.

Tips for Finding Quality and Durability in Kids' Apparel

When shopping for kids' clothes, quality is key. Look for sturdy stitching and reinforced knees on pants. Choose fabrics that can withstand frequent washing. Natural fibers like cotton are often more durable than synthetics. Check for adjustable features like elasticized waists. These allow clothes to fit longer as kids grow. Read reviews from other parents before buying. Pay attention to care instructions to maintain quality. Invest in classic pieces that can be worn in multiple seasons. Consider hand-me-down potential when choosing styles. Quality clothes may cost more upfront but last longer.

Balancing Cost and Style: Budget-Friendly Shopping

Stylish kids' clothes don't have to break the bank. Look for sales and end-of-season clearances. Sign up for store newsletters to get discount codes. Consider buying basics in bulk when on sale. Mix high-end pieces with more affordable items. Thrift stores and consignment shops offer unique finds at low prices. Online marketplaces have gently used designer kids' clothes. Swap clothes with friends or family members. DIY projects can update plain items with trendy touches. Set a budget for each season and stick to it. Remember that kids grow fast, so don't overspend on any one item.
